The Department of Veterans Affairs is procuring the replacement and expansion of Ophthalmic Eye Lanes at the Overton Brooks VA Medical Center (OBVAMC) in Shreveport, Louisiana. This requirement is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ial items under FAR Part 12 and FAR Part 13. The agency plans to award a contract for the delivery, installation, and training for four complete ophthalmic diagnostic systems to support the facility's Ophthalmology Clinic. The solicitation is a Request for Quotation (RFQ) under number 36C25626Q0868 and is 100% set aside for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Businesses (SDVOSB). Quotes must be submitted electronically to the contracting point of contact by the June 2026 deadline. The procurement follows the terms in Standard Form 1449 and its attachments, which establish the technical baseline for the medical equipment. The government will evaluate competitive quotes based on the technical specifications and instructions in the solicitation package. The VA requires the replacement of two existing ophthalmic eye lanes and the addition of two new lanes to increase clinical capacity at the Overton Brooks VA Medical Center (OBVAMC).
